AI Code Review - COMMENT

Summary: This PR fixes two issues in push notifications: (1) sending accountId directly instead of parsing the email local part for notification matching, and (2) correcting the heartbeat payload to use the message field, reference /hooks/agent, and include a sender name.

Actionable Feedback (1 item):

  • notifications.ts:116 - The request body still uses the field name email_user_id even though the value is now accountId (an atxp_acct_* identifier). If the server API expects account_id instead, this will silently fail to match. Confirm the server accepts email_user_id with an account ID value, or rename the field.

Code Quality: The rename from getEmailUserId to getAccountId is clean. Returning account?.accountId directly rather than parsing the email removes a fragile implicit contract. The heartbeat fixes (field text->message, endpoint /hooks/wake->/hooks/agent, adding name field) are small, consistent corrections.

Security: No concerns. No credentials are logged or exposed.

Suggestion: Consider renaming the email_user_id key in the request body to account_id to match the semantics of what is being sent. Keeping the old key name is confusing for future maintainers.

Positive Notes: Removing email-parsing logic (split on @) is a good simplification. The PR description clearly explains the intent of each change.

AI Code Review

Recommendation: APPROVE

Summary
This PR fixes two bugs in the ATXP notification system: it corrects the identifier sent to the notifications API (using account_id directly instead of parsing an email string), and fixes the heartbeat payload (message/name fields, /hooks/agent endpoint reference).

Actionable Feedback

  • General: Existing agents with a HEARTBEAT.md file will still reference /hooks/wake instead of the new /hooks/agent endpoint. If the old endpoint is being deprecated, consider whether a migration path is needed for existing sessions.

Code Quality
The rename from getEmailUserId to getAccountId is a clear improvement. Parsing identifiers out of email strings is fragile; returning the accountId field directly is more robust and semantically correct. Variable names, the API body key (email_user_id to account_id), and surrounding comments are all updated consistently. The heartbeat payload fix (text field renamed to message, addition of name field) is a straightforward correction aligning the request with the API contract.

Security
No security concerns. No new attack surface introduced.

Suggestions
Consider adding a comment about what accountId format is expected (e.g., atxp_acct_*) to aid future maintenance.

Positive Notes

  • The diff is minimal and focused - only touches what is necessary to fix the bugs.
  • The PR description clearly explains the reasoning behind each change.
  • Removing the email-parsing logic eliminates a source of subtle bugs.
